Factors Influencing Dry Eye Growth



Dry eye syndrome can be affected by different elements that contribute to its advancement. One substantial variable is age. As you age, your eyes may generate fewer splits or tears of lower top quality, resulting in dry skin.

Particular medical problems like diabetic issues, thyroid disorders, and autoimmune illness can also affect tear manufacturing and high quality, exacerbating dry eye signs and symptoms. Hormonal modifications, especially in females during menopause, can contribute to completely dry eyes also.

Additionally, medications such as antihistamines, decongestants, and antidepressants can lower tear production and trigger dryness. Ecological factors like smoke, wind, and completely dry air can aggravate the eyes and aggravate completely dry eye symptoms.

In addition, extended screen time and digital tool use can bring about reduced blinking, leading to insufficient tear circulation throughout the eyes. Environmental Triggers and Dry Eye



Exposure to various ecological aspects can dramatically impact the growth and worsening of dry eye signs. Toxins like dirt, smoke, and air pollution can aggravate the eyes, bring about increased tear dissipation and dry skin.

Climate conditions such as reduced moisture levels, high temperatures, and gusty weather condition can additionally contribute to moisture loss from the eyes, triggering discomfort and dry eye signs. Additionally, spending extended periods in air-conditioned or warmed environments can lower air moisture, further aggravating dry eye.

Long term use electronic displays, typical in today's technology-driven globe, can additionally stress the eyes and minimize blink prices, bring about not enough tear production and completely dry eye problems. To reduce the influence of environmental triggers on completely dry eye, take into consideration making use of a humidifier, taking breaks from display time, wearing safety eyeglasses in windy conditions, and making use of fabricated rips or lubricating eye drops as needed.
